The first product I tried was the Island Breeze Moisturizing Whip. This is a moisturizing whip for the hair and or scalp that can be used on wet or dry 2-3 times per week or as needed. It contains Shea and Mango butters, Coconut and Avocado oils as well as Pro Vitamin B 5 just to name a few.

Here’s what I like about it…it is very moisturizing but no so much that it leaves your hair greasy. It smells wonderful but it is not overpowering. A little goes a long way; it is very lightweight and great for dry scalp. It gives great shine and does not leave a build up on hair. What I really love the most is that all hair types can use it from relaxed to natural.
